The Importance of Cooking Sausage Thoroughly
Consuming undercooked sausage can lead to foodborne illnesses caused by harmful bacteria such as Salmonella, E. coli, and Trichinella. These bacteria can survive if the sausage isn’t heated to a high enough internal temperature. Thorough cooking eliminates these risks, ensuring a safe and enjoyable meal. Beyond safety, proper cooking enhances the flavor and texture of the sausage. Perfectly cooked sausage is juicy, flavorful, and has a satisfying snap.
Understanding Internal Temperature: The Gold Standard
The most reliable method for determining if a sausage is fully cooked is by checking its internal temperature using a food thermometer. Different types of sausage require different internal temperatures to ensure they are safe to eat. Always use a calibrated food thermometer for accurate readings.
Recommended Internal Temperatures for Different Sausage Types
Raw sausages, such as fresh pork sausage, Italian sausage, and bratwurst, should be cooked to an internal temperature of 160°F (71°C). Pre-cooked sausages, like smoked sausage or hot dogs, only need to be heated through to an internal temperature of 140°F (60°C). Always consult specific product packaging for cooking instructions, as manufacturer recommendations may vary.
How to Use a Food Thermometer Correctly
Insert the food thermometer into the thickest part of the sausage, being careful not to touch any bone. Hold the thermometer in place until the temperature reading stabilizes. For smaller sausages, insert the thermometer from the end, ensuring the probe is in the center of the sausage. Clean the thermometer thoroughly with soap and hot water after each use to prevent cross-contamination.
Visual Cues: What to Look For
While internal temperature is the most reliable indicator, visual cues can also provide helpful clues about doneness. Pay close attention to the color and texture of the sausage as it cooks.
Color Changes During Cooking
Raw sausage typically has a pinkish hue. As it cooks, the color will gradually change to a grayish-brown throughout. The center of the sausage should no longer be pink. However, color alone is not a foolproof indicator of doneness, as some sausages may retain a slightly pink color even when fully cooked due to curing agents.
Texture and Firmness
Cooked sausage should feel firm to the touch. When pressed gently with a spatula or tongs, it should offer some resistance. Undercooked sausage will feel soft and squishy. Overcooked sausage will feel very firm and may start to shrink and wrinkle.
The Importance of Juices
As sausage cooks, it will release juices. The juices should run clear, not pink or red. You can test this by piercing the sausage with a fork or knife and observing the color of the escaping liquid. Clear juices indicate that the sausage is likely cooked through, but it’s still essential to confirm with a food thermometer.
Cooking Methods and Their Impact on Doneness
The cooking method significantly affects how evenly and quickly sausage cooks. Different methods require different techniques to ensure proper doneness.
Pan-Frying: Achieving a Golden-Brown Crust
Pan-frying is a popular method for cooking sausage. Start by adding a small amount of oil to a skillet over medium heat. Place the sausages in the skillet, ensuring they are not overcrowded. Cook for several minutes on each side, turning frequently, until they are browned and cooked through. To prevent the outside from browning too quickly while the inside remains undercooked, you can reduce the heat to medium-low and add a tablespoon or two of water to the skillet. Cover the skillet and allow the sausages to steam until they reach the desired internal temperature.
Grilling: Smoky Flavor and Char
Grilling imparts a smoky flavor to sausage. Preheat the grill to medium heat. Place the sausages on the grill grates and cook for several minutes on each side, turning frequently, until they are browned and cooked through. To prevent flare-ups, avoid piercing the sausages with a fork, as this will release fat and cause the grill to smoke excessively. Consider using indirect heat for thicker sausages to ensure they cook evenly without burning the outside.
Baking: An Oven-Friendly Approach
Baking is a convenient method for cooking a large batch of sausages. Preheat the oven to 350°F (175°C). Place the sausages on a baking sheet lined with parchment paper. Bake for 20-30 minutes, or until they are cooked through, turning them halfway through the cooking time to ensure even browning.
Boiling: A Quick but Potentially Flavor-Draining Method
Boiling sausage is a quick method, but it can leach out some of the flavor. Place the sausages in a pot of boiling water and cook for 10-15 minutes, or until they are cooked through. After boiling, you can pan-fry or grill the sausages briefly to add color and flavor.
Air Frying: A Crispy and Convenient Option
Air frying has become a popular cooking method for sausage, offering a crispy exterior with minimal oil. Preheat the air fryer to 375°F (190°C). Place the sausages in the air fryer basket in a single layer. Cook for 12-15 minutes, or until they are cooked through, flipping them halfway through the cooking time.
Dealing with Different Types of Sausage
Different sausages have different compositions and may require slight adjustments in cooking techniques.
Fresh Sausage
Fresh sausages, such as Italian sausage and breakfast sausage, are made from raw ground meat and require thorough cooking. Always cook fresh sausage to an internal temperature of 160°F (71°C).
Pre-Cooked Sausage
Pre-cooked sausages, such as smoked sausage and hot dogs, have already been cooked during processing. These sausages only need to be heated through to an internal temperature of 140°F (60°C).
Sausage Patties
Sausage patties are often made from ground pork or a blend of meats. Cook sausage patties in a skillet over medium heat until they are browned and cooked through to an internal temperature of 160°F (71°C).
Sausage Links
Sausage links can be cooked using various methods, including pan-frying, grilling, baking, and boiling. Ensure they are cooked to the appropriate internal temperature for the type of sausage.
Troubleshooting Common Sausage Cooking Problems
Even with careful attention, problems can arise during sausage cooking. Knowing how to troubleshoot these issues can help you achieve perfect results.
Sausage Browning Too Quickly
If the sausage is browning too quickly on the outside while remaining undercooked inside, reduce the heat and consider adding a small amount of water or broth to the pan. Cover the pan and allow the sausage to steam until it is cooked through.
Sausage is Dry and Overcooked
Overcooked sausage can become dry and tough. To prevent this, avoid cooking sausage at high heat for extended periods. Use a food thermometer to monitor the internal temperature and remove the sausage from the heat as soon as it reaches the desired temperature.
Sausage is Bursting Open
Sausage can burst open during cooking if the casing is too tight or if the sausage is cooked at too high of a temperature. To prevent bursting, avoid piercing the sausage before cooking and cook it at a moderate temperature.
Tips for Perfect Sausage Every Time
Consistent success in cooking sausage requires a combination of knowledge and practice. Here are some key tips to help you achieve perfectly cooked sausage every time:
- Invest in a good quality food thermometer: Accuracy is crucial for ensuring food safety.
- Don’t overcrowd the pan: Overcrowding can lower the temperature of the pan and prevent even cooking.
- Turn sausages frequently: Turning sausages frequently ensures even browning and prevents burning.
- Allow sausages to rest: After cooking, let the sausages rest for a few minutes before serving. This allows the juices to redistribute, resulting in a more flavorful and juicy sausage.
- Consider poaching first: Poaching the sausage gently in water or broth before frying can help to cook the inside more evenly.
Sausage Doneness Chart
Here’s a handy chart summarizing the recommended internal temperatures for various types of sausage:
Sausage Type | Minimum Internal Temperature |
---|---|
Fresh Pork Sausage | 160°F (71°C) |
Italian Sausage | 160°F (71°C) |
Bratwurst | 160°F (71°C) |
Smoked Sausage | 140°F (60°C) |
Hot Dogs | 140°F (60°C) |

What is the most reliable way to check if my sausage is cooked through?
The most reliable way to ensure your sausage is fully cooked is to use a meat thermometer. Insert the thermometer into the thickest part of the sausage, avoiding any bone or casing. The internal temperature should reach 160°F (71°C) for pork, beef, and lamb sausages, and 165°F (74°C) for poultry sausages like chicken or turkey sausage.
Remember that carryover cooking will slightly raise the temperature after you remove the sausage from the heat. Therefore, you can safely remove it when it reaches 5-10 degrees below the target temperature, and it will continue to cook while resting. Always confirm with a thermometer, as visual cues alone can be misleading.
Can I tell if a sausage is cooked just by looking at it?
While visual cues can be helpful, they are not a completely reliable indicator of doneness. Cooked sausage will typically have a firm texture and a casing that has browned or crisped, depending on the cooking method. The juices that run from the sausage should be clear or light-colored, not pink or red.
However, color can be influenced by factors such as the type of sausage, the presence of nitrates or nitrites, and the cooking method. Therefore, relying solely on visual inspection can lead to either undercooked or overcooked sausage. Always use a meat thermometer to confirm the internal temperature.
What happens if I undercook my sausage?
Undercooking sausage can pose significant health risks due to the potential presence of harmful bacteria, such as Salmonella, E. coli, or Trichinella spiralis. These bacteria can cause foodborne illnesses, leading to symptoms like nausea, vomiting, abdominal cramps, diarrhea, and fever. In severe cases, these illnesses can be life-threatening, especially for vulnerable populations like children, pregnant women, and the elderly.
To avoid these risks, always ensure that sausage reaches the recommended internal temperature as measured with a meat thermometer. Never consume sausage that appears raw or undercooked, even if it seems mostly cooked. Thorough cooking is essential for eliminating harmful pathogens.
What are some common mistakes people make when cooking sausage?
One common mistake is cooking sausage over too high of heat. This can cause the outside to burn before the inside is fully cooked, leading to a sausage that is charred on the outside but still raw in the center. Another frequent error is piercing the sausage casing repeatedly, which allows the juices to escape, resulting in a dry and less flavorful sausage.
Additionally, failing to use a meat thermometer is a major oversight, as relying solely on visual cues can be inaccurate. Lastly, overcrowding the pan or grill can lower the temperature and lead to uneven cooking. Always cook sausage slowly and evenly, using a thermometer to confirm doneness, and avoid piercing the casing unnecessarily.
How does the type of sausage affect cooking time?
The type of sausage significantly impacts cooking time due to differences in size, thickness, and ingredients. Thicker sausages, like bratwurst, will require longer cooking times compared to thinner sausages, such as breakfast links. Sausages made with coarser ground meat may also take longer to cook through.
Additionally, pre-cooked sausages, like some smoked sausages, only need to be heated through, while raw sausages require thorough cooking to reach a safe internal temperature. Always consult the package instructions for specific cooking recommendations based on the type of sausage you are preparing, and verify doneness with a meat thermometer.
What is the best way to cook sausage to ensure it’s evenly cooked?
To ensure even cooking, start by using a medium-low heat. This allows the sausage to cook slowly and thoroughly without burning the outside. If cooking in a pan, use a small amount of oil or water to prevent sticking and promote even browning. Turn the sausages frequently to ensure all sides are cooked uniformly.
Alternatively, poaching sausages in water or broth before pan-frying or grilling can help cook them evenly and prevent the casings from bursting. After poaching, transfer the sausages to a hot pan or grill to brown and crisp the exterior. No matter the method, always finish by verifying the internal temperature with a meat thermometer.
Can I refreeze cooked sausage?
Yes, you can refreeze cooked sausage, but it is best to do so as quickly as possible after cooking and cooling it properly. Allowing cooked sausage to sit at room temperature for an extended period can encourage bacterial growth. Wrap the sausage tightly in freezer-safe packaging, such as plastic wrap or a freezer bag, to prevent freezer burn.
Keep in mind that the quality of refrozen sausage may be slightly diminished compared to freshly cooked sausage. It may become drier or have a slightly altered texture. Use the refrozen sausage within a few months for the best quality. Always thaw the sausage in the refrigerator before reheating to ensure even thawing and minimize bacterial growth.
